Good news—Mr. Grinch has finally been caught for stealing Christmas! His punishment? Time behind bars at the Texas Jailhouse in Palestine. While in lockup, the mean, green Grinch has done some reflecting on his prior misdeeds, and he’s decided to spread cheer rather than hate this holiday season. He’ll give you a personal tour of his lair, which is brimming with whimsy and Christmas magic, much like the town of Whoville.
On Fridays, Saturdays, and Sundays from November 20 thru December 20, you can visit the mean, green Mr. Grinch at the Texas Jailhouse in Palestine.

Tickets are $10 each, and reservations must be made in advance. It’s easy—just visit the Texas Jailhouse website, select your desired five-minute time slot, and pay.

Time slots are available between 12 p.m. and 6 p.m. Visit the Texas Jailhouse website or Facebook page to learn more.
